See More Details >>Embarking on a career in the mechanical trade in Juneau, AK, typically begins with an apprenticeship, blending hands-on experience with classroom instruction, allowing individuals to earn while they learn. Apprenticeships span approximately three to four years, demanding extensive training under seasoned professionals. According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, there are 510 mechanical trade professionals in Juneau, with an average weekly wage of $1,252.50. The job outlook is promising, with a projected growth rate of 11% from 2023 to 2033.
